The Devil's Owl-hd

The Devil's Owl

HD
IMDB: 0.6
87 min
Overview:
A girl gives birth to an owl creature and this monster rallies all its furry friends into a bloody revolt against the humans for their savage behavior.
Duration: 87 min
Revenue: 0
tagline: ,